- 5 servings jumbo refrigerated biscuits, cut into quarters
- 1/4 teaspoon stick butter or margarine, melted
- 1 1/4 cups Equal® Spoonful
- 2 1/2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
- 2 medium Granny Smith apples, peeled, cored, sliced into thin circles, cut in half
- 3 tablespoons apple juice concentrate, thawed
- Roll biscuit quarters in melted butter. Coat biscuit pieces with combined Equal(r) Spoonful and cinnamon.
- Arrange biscuits in 8-inch round cake pan.
- Stand 8 apple halves around the edge. Fill in remaining apples pieces between the biscuit quarters.
- Sprinkle any remaining butter and Equal(r)/cinnamon mixture over the top.
- Drizzle thawed apple juice over the top. Bake in preheated 375 degrees F oven 20 to 25 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m.
